Type
ORACLE
Validation date
2025-02-24 17:34: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00745,
    "usd": 0.00781
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E30D3A1B038AFB5CD64CC3E90108418CA22841F6B908DE2947EFBD0A4D7B7CE3

Previous signature

44C985A43F2B8FF3E7F3BD03B8B6CF0A7B04EE669C65ED3EDDC80D35B59D078704286CED32F84499C256CC132AECB83D6A8C1EBC5BE1F3CFCDB76407D6F74D0F

Origin signature

304502207F5E772F0765D7B3C94F2769AC61A38B30899F9540E60FCDA16E30F91E5CE4EC022100919B7ED942FE0D6E8C09E4C30646710E1EA7DCD837830EA5D42B5AF95D18C3AF

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

00360F8B3F04749C610DF421D9E3EA7A4B2F8F26C164538E1CE47EC9605FBE8825

Coordinator signature

672A64EABB5714B1952BD24D3CCBD69EE84D65C012CDA0D996864E7779CDC5C183394614C0C3BFC8C9AEF053E6D9D0AFE8900BD053F6B5A1A34AF3A2AD061409

Validator #1 public key

000106C25CB6B500CD3CD63D2880094D6415DB22328D43ED2E6F1C031D6C9E115E39

Validator #1 signature

F06F6F64CC213771F17EE62E7BA65D5FDCD1FD5CAAC92497F111CE2E34C41B9C2C01DE901F3E53B91D9A50666F811C15B6E0CC106AA815D2FC48F1D5EB494F0C

Validator #2 public key

0001899B0CBACEC8396CDC98258D29B397446B8876D6941BC045EBF5526A4BC38DA3

Validator #2 signature

7E809DD68364A7124788394BF350F3DB1FAD430AE4C1CE541FAB5DBAC7E935F6C42CBCA30FDEE09D1C8EA577C8AA272B331CD6259289DE75046D452ED8786409